Unlike fresh wreaths, this sculptural piece will last for several years and visitors will never guess how easy they are to put together. Begin by tracing the external edge of a 18-inch craft ring right onto a piece of poster board and cutting it out (hello pumpkin door sign). Glue the poster board to the ring kind and position seven-inch wood cones to slightly go beyond the edge of the formthen, glue it in location with hot glue.

Repeat with four-inch cones, working towards the center. The cones will slowly become more upright as you go. Lastly, tack the points of the innermost cones to the poster board, along with to each other, and let the development dry totally for about five minutes.
